On the Wilford training ground, Bale shaded his eyes with his hands and looked up at the sky. He said, "The weather is fine today." His surroundings were clear as a crystal, and the sun was vibrant. "We will play our last league game in good weather."

"That's good. I hate the rain,"Şahin said. As a technical midfielder, the pitch being wet was extremely torturous for him.

The team had just finished a training session and gathered to rest. The atmosphere among the Forest team had always been good. During breaks, the players would get together and chat.

The conversation naturally shifted to the ownership of the league title. Nottingham Forest's players were sensible. Everyone knew that the decision of who gained the league title was not just up to them.

"I called Bendtner yesterday," Bale said. Everyone looked at him.

"I asked him if he was starting in the match. He was sure he was starting. I told him I hoped he did his best to beat Arsenal..."
